I have a 2003 Accord LX 2.4L. I bought this about 2 months ago. I just realized that the car should have come with a remote that was built into the key. I went back to the used car dealership where I bought the car and they showed me the paperwork when they bought it that it only came with the Valet Key. Is there a way that I can get a new key. I read that you can get a copy for about 150$ from a Honda Dealership but no one has said wether it comes with the remote or not. If not is there another system I could put in the car that would allow me to lock and unlock the car doors?

You definitely should be able to get the honda key/remote combo.

There may be some honda remotes (maybe the TSX?) where the stand-alone remote would work on your accord. I think the FCCID would have to be the same between a remote on your car and the donor when looking on sites like Ebay.

I used to have a 1998 Accord and a 2003 Accord at the same time. Just for grins, I programmed their remote-lock transmitters across both cars and it worked. So I could use the 98 remote to unlock the 03 doors.

the other problem with just the valet key is that you can't lock/unlock the manual trunk release and the same with the glove box. you could get a complete key off ebay for 35-40 bucks, but you'll still need it cut and programmed to the car. save some time chasing your tail and just go to the dealer, and make sure they reprogram the current key you have as well or it won't start the car. key should be about 75 bucks(includes cutting) and around 100 to program both. and NO, locksmiths can't program the keys.

That's some kind of aftermarket key, but it must be made for Honda and it must have an immobilizer chip - otherwise it wouldn't start the engine. But it doesn't have a "H" emblem molded into the plastic head.

That's not a valet key, because the actual valet key will not work the lever on the floor, and won't work the glovebox. The valet key has a grey plastic head, with an "H" emblem.

My 2003 Accord LX 4-cyl 4-door had a key cylinder in the right-side tail-lamp cluster. The part of the lamp that's on the trunk lid. It's not centered on the trunk lid.
